PM Orchestrator (Lite)

Note: This version does not use fork subagents. All agents run directly in the current session.

Role

Orchestrator that sequentially executes PM analysis skills and constructs the final agent chain.

Input

Automatically collects the following:

  • userMessage: User request
  • gitBranch: Current branch
  • gitStatus: Git status (clean/dirty)
  • recentCommits: Recent commit list
  • openFiles: Open file list

Workflow

2. Sequential PM Skill Execution

2.0 Large Specification Handling

2.0.1 Check Specification Size

  • Count words in userMessage
  • Trigger summarization if > tokenBudget.specSummaryTrigger (2000 words)
  • Trigger task splitting if independent features > tokenBudget.splitTrigger (5)

2.0.2 Summarize Specification

  1. Save original to {tasksRoot}/{feature-name}/archives/specification-full.md
  2. Extract core elements only
  3. Write summary to {tasksRoot}/{feature-name}/specification.md

2.0.3 Split into Subtasks If single spec covers multiple independent areas, split into subtasks/ directory.

3.1 Dynamic Skill Injection

Inject skills dynamically when signals are detected during skillChain execution:

Signal Condition Inserted Skill Insertion Point
buildFailed Bash exit code ≠ 0 build-error-resolver Before retry
securityConcern Changed files contain .env, auth, password, token security-reviewer After codex-review-code
reactProject .tsx/.jsx files or React keywords vercel-react-best-practices After codex-review-code

3.2 Project Memory Review (Direct Execution)

After codex-review-code, directly execute project-memory-reviewer:

Task tool: project-memory-reviewer (subagent_type: general-purpose)
Input: { projectId, changedFiles, projectMemoryContext, diff }

Receive Violation Report:

yaml
memoryReviewResult:
  status: "passed" | "failed" | "needs_approval"
  violations: [...]     # NeverDo violations
  needsApproval: [...]  # AskFirst items
  warnings: [...]       # Convention/spec warnings
  reminders: [...]      # AlwaysDo reminders

Result Handling:

  • status: "failed": Stop execution, report violations to user
  • status: "needs_approval": Request user approval before proceeding
  • status: "passed": Proceed to next step

3.3 Completion Verification Loop

After implementation-runner completes, call completion-verifier. Retry up to retryCount < 2 if allPassed: false.

Error Handling

  1. Skill execution failure: Log error to notes and report to user
  2. Undefined step: Request user confirmation
  3. Question infinite loop: Max 3 questions limit
  4. Token limit warning: Archive and summarize before continuing

Contract

  • This skill only orchestrates other PM skills, does not analyze directly
  • All analysis logic delegated to individual PM skills
  • Does not use fork - all agents run directly in current session
  • Document memory policy: Follow .claude/docs/guidelines/document-memory-policy.md
